Overview
Malhadizes is a 12 MW onshore wind farm in Portugal, operational and contributing to the country's renewable energy capacity. It supports Portugal's transition to clean energy under EU Renewable Energy Directive targets.
Malhadizes is an operational onshore wind farm located in Portugal, with a capacity of 12 megawatts. As a wind energy facility, it plays a role in Portugal's renewable energy portfolio, which is among the most advanced in Europe. The plant's location in the central region benefits from consistent wind patterns typical of the area. The facility operates under Portugal's national renewable energy framework, which aligns with the EU Renewable Energy Directive III (2023/2413) targeting 42.5% renewable energy by 2030. Onshore wind is a mature technology in Portugal, and Malhadizes contributes to the country's goal of carbon neutrality. The 12 MW capacity places it in the small-to-medium scale range for wind farms in the region. Environmentally, the wind farm helps reduce greenhouse gas emissions by displacing fossil fuel generation. Its operation supports local grid stability and contributes to Portugal's high share of renewable electricity, which often exceeds 50% annually. The facility also demonstrates the viability of distributed wind energy in rural areas.
Environmental context
Portugal's central region features varied topography and wind corridors that are suitable for wind energy development. Onshore wind farms like Malhadizes can have visual impacts on the landscape and require careful siting to minimize effects on local bird and bat populations. The facility operates in a region with moderate biodiversity, and its environmental footprint is managed through standard mitigation measures such as turbine curtailment during migration periods.
